Foundations of Artificial Intelligence
-
10 lessons
What is intelligence, and how does AI compare to human intelligence? What are different approaches to defining and developing AI? How does AI interact with its environment using the PEAS framework? What are different types of AI solutions? How does AI impact daily life? What is an AI agent?
Machine Learning Fundamentals
-
10 lessons
What is machine learning, and how does it differ from traditional programming? What are the different types of machine learning? How does AI use data to learn and improve? What are common challenges like bias and overfitting? What are neural networks, and how do they function?
Generative AI
-
7 lessons
What is generative AI, and how does it differ from other AI models? How do AI models generate text and images? How is generative AI used in creative fields? What are the limitations and ethical concerns of generative AI?
Practical AI Skills
-
6 lessons
How do you write effective AI p rompts? How can AI-generated outputs be evaluated for accuracy? What strategies can improve AI interactions? What are the responsibilities of AI users?
AI and Ethics
-
6 lessons
What are the key ethical concerns in AI? How does AI affect privacy and data security? How can bias in AI models be identified and mitigated? How does AI impact jobs, education, and society?
